Resolving insolvency: Cost in Qatar
Qatar: Resolving insolvency: Cost was 22.0% in 2019. ▬ Flat
Resolving insolvency: Cost in Qatar, 2007–2019
Source: World Bank. Measured in % of estate.
Analysis
In 2019, resolving insolvency: cost in Qatar stood at 22.0%. That is the highest value across all 13 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is unchanged over ten years.
Over the whole period, resolving insolvency: cost in Qatar peaked at 22.0% in 2007 and was at its lowest, 22.0%, in 2007.
Qatar ranks 29th of 167 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

About this data
The cost to resolve insolvency is the cost of the proceedings is recorded as a percentage of the value of the debtor’s estate, including court fees and government levies, fees of insolvency administrators, auctioneers, assessors and lawyers, and all other fees and costs.
